In the current year, Mr. A, a sole proprietor, made interest payments of $800 on his personal credit cards, $650 on his business truck loan, $3,000 to the bank for a loan origination fee (charge for services) for his Veterans Administration mortgage, and $8,000 on his home mortgage. What is the total allowable interest deduction on Schedule A, Form 1040? A. $8,000 B. $9,450 C. $11,800 OD. $12,450 Mrs. Walter donated stock she had purchased in Year 1 for $30,000 to a private nonoperating foundation in Year 3, when the stock was valued at $42,000. Mrs. Walter had adjusted gross income in Year 3 of $90,000. If the stock donation was the only charitable contribution in Year 3, what is Mrs. Walter's Year 3 charitable contribution deduction? A. $27,000 B. $42,000 C. $30,000 D. $18,000
